Leadership challenges in modern organisations
Most leaders have developed their skills in the traditional context of projects and managing tasks. This management style does not work well with Knowledge Workers and the needs of digital to develop initiative and ownership in the teams.
Transformation efforts often focus on (agile) processes and a better delivery, which are not enough. A new balance of relationship is needed between leadership and teams, which can only be coached with professional systemic techniques.
Working in a more systemic way favouring collaboration is still an emergent practice in organisations as much of the operating model is designed around individual leadership taking accountability / responsibility, and not teams. Realigning and co-evolving the skills and practices is a substantial change and coaching challenge.
